How can companies measure the impact of incorporating customer feedback into their product and service improvements, and what strategies can they use to continuously improve this process?

Feedback Loop
Companies can measure the impact of incorporating customer feedback by tracking key performance indicators such as customer satisfaction scores, retention rates, and repeat purchases. They can also conduct surveys and interviews to gather qualitative feedback on specific improvements made based on customer input. To continuously improve this process, companies can establish a feedback loop by regularly collecting and analyzing customer feedback, implementing changes based on this feedback, and then collecting feedback on the effectiveness of these changes. Additionally, companies can invest in technology tools such as customer feedback software to streamline the feedback collection and analysis process.
